This easement shall burden the above -designated Tax Parcel ("Parent Parcel") legally described in Exhibit C: SEE EXHIBITS "A", "B" AND "C", ATTACHED HERETO AND BY THIS REFERENCE MADE A PART HEREOF. Grantee shall have the absolute right, at times as may be necessary, for immediate entry upon said Easement Area for the purpose of maintenance, inspection, construction, repair or reconstruction of the above improvements without incurring any legal obligation or liability therefore. Grantee shall have the absolute right to place any type of driving surface within the Easement Area deemed necessary by the Grantee. Grantee shall have the absolute right to relocate the easement on the Grantor's property, provided that the easement relocation area does not substantially interfere with Grantor's operations or existing structures. Grantor shall not be entitled to any compensation associated with the easement relocation. Grantor shall not in any way block, restrict or impede access and egress to or from the Easement Area, and/or in any way block, restrict or impede full use of the real property within the Easement Area by the Grantee for the above-described purposes. Other than what might exist at the time of execution of this easement, no building, wall, rockery, fence, trees or structure of any kind shall be erected or planted, nor shall any fill material be placed within the boundaries of the Wes- 109571$ 1ST AMO Instrument Number: 20220113001768 Document:EAS Rec: 5209.50 Page -2 of 7 Record Date:1/13/2022 4:59 PM King County, WA Easement Area, without the express written consent of the Grantee. With Grantee permission, Grantor may fence across said Easement Area and/or along the boundaries of the Easement Area, provided that a gate is constructed in the fence. The gate shall be of sufficient length and location to allow the Grantee full use of, and access and egress to and from the Easement Area. If the gate is to be locked, keys shall be provided to the Grantee. Without the written permission of the City Public Works Director and City Engineer, no excavation shall be made within three (3) feet of the water service facilities and the surface level of the ground within the Easement Area shall be maintained at the elevation as currently existing. Grantor shall have the right to relocate the existing water utility should Grantor elect to redevelop, improve, or have some other specific need, cause or desire. If Grantor desires to have the utility relocated Grantor shall work with Grantee in good faith to determine a new location that is acceptable to both parties. As part of the relocation Grantor shall provide Grantee with a complete legal description describing and depicting the new agreed upon location for the utility and both parties agree to record a new utility easement substantially in the same form as this easement describing and depicting the new agreed upon location. Immediately following recording of the new utility easement or Grantor's abandonment of those facilities described herein, whichever happens last, Grantee shall execute a release of easement for that area described in Exhibit A and depicted in Exhibit B. All costs and fees associated with the utility relocation, including permit fees, construction costs, survey, recording of a new utility easement and release of the abandoned easement shall be the responsibility of the Grantor. Grantor accepts all risk of loss to Grantor's property and its improvements and further agrees to defend, indemnify, and hold harmless Grantee, its consultants, employees, elected officials, agents, representatives, or designees from all liability, claims, damages, losses, and expenses, whether direct, indirect, or consequential, including, but not limited to, reasonable attorneys' fees, expert witness fees, and other expenses of litigation resulting from personal injury or property damage arising out of or in connection with Grantee's water utility facilities within the Easement Area. Grantor grants to the Grantee the right of ingress and egress to the Easement Area over and across all paved, graveled, or otherwise improved driveways or parking lots within the Parent Parcel. If direct access to the Easement Area is not available from such driveways or parking lots, the Grantee's right of ingress and egress shall include such other areas within the Parent Parcel as the Grantee determines are necessary to access the Easement Area from such driveways and parking lots or from the Parent Parcel's boundaries. In the case of any damage or disruption of the Parent Parcel, the Grantee shall return the property to a condition reasonably comparable to its condition as it existed immediately before entry and/or work was made thereon by the Grantee or its agents. Grantor additionally grants to the Grantee, the use of such additional area immediately adjacent to the Easement Area as shall be required for the construction, reconstruction, maintenance and operation of said water facilities. The use of such additional area shall be held to a reasonable minimum and in the case of any damage or disruption of the Parent Parcel, the Grantee shall return the property to a condition reasonably comparable to its condition as it existed immediately before entry and/or work was performed by the Grantee or its agents. In addition to the other restrictions herein, Grantor shall not convey to a third party any easement or other right of usage in the Parent Parcel that would impair or limit the Grantee's use of the Easement Area. This Easement shall be a covenant running with the Parent Parcel shall burden said real estate, and shall be binding on the successors, heirs and assigns of all parties hereto.
